Abstract

With the development of computer technology and simulative technology, computer-based case simulations (CCS) are widely used in medical education, which plays a more and more important role in the evaluation and education of medical students' clinical competency. American National Board of Medical Examiners has done a lot of work to test the reliability and validity of CCS, scoring method, influencing factors, and the operational behavior of examinees. In 1999 , computer-based case simulations formally began to apply in the United States Medical Licensing Examination (USMLE).In recent years, some colleges and universities in the United States have begun to research and develop operating systems similar to that of CCS, used for teaching and evaluation on the clinical competence of medical students.
